    in response to deep sea question, it's quite important.

    a deep sea borders several other zones so keeping a ship in every deep sea zone means that trade routes are less likely cut due to a storm or blockade in 1 sea zone.

    furthermore, deep sea ships can move through these zones to reach places faster for naval combat.

    also, deep water fleets while the AI doesn't ahve one means that you can raid his shipping while he can't even touch you
